How they compare

Nepal currently reports 1,479 1000 USD against 868 1000 USD in Sierra Leone, a difference of 611 1000 USD.

That makes Nepal's figure about 1.7 times Sierra Leone's.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 31 shared years of data; in 1994 it was Nepal ahead.

Nepal ranks 120th and Sierra Leone ranks 123rd of 199 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Nepal averaged higher in 1 and Sierra Leone in 3.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
